Sheet Names and Organization
The template consists of four primary sheets:
- Summary Dashboard: The central hub offering high-level insights into monthly budget performance.
- Monthly Budget Tracker: Detailed breakdown of income, expenses, and savings categorized by type and date.
- Process Documentation Log: A structured log that records the decision-making processes behind budget adjustments, financial goals, and unexpected changes.
- Data Reference & Setup: Contains predefined lists (categories, payment methods), formula definitions, and configuration settings for template maintenance.
Table Structures and Data Types
1. Summary Dashboard Sheet
This sheet contains three main tables:
- Budget Performance Overview (Table 1): Displays key metrics such as Total Income, Total Expenses, Net Savings, Budget vs Actual variance.
- Monthly Category Allocation (Table 2): Shows percentage distribution of spending across categories (e.g., Housing: 30%, Groceries: 15%).
- Trend Analysis Graphs (Table 3): Includes data for time-series charts showing monthly changes in income and expenses.
2. Monthly Budget Tracker Sheet
This table includes the following columns with their respective data types:
| Column | Data Type | Description |
|---|---|---|
| Date | Date (DD/MM/YYYY) | Transaction date. |
| Category | Text (from dropdown list) | Selected from predefined categories: Income, Housing, Utilities, Groceries, Transportation, Entertainment, Health Care, Education, Savings & Investments. |
| Description | Text | Short description of the transaction (e.g., "Electricity bill", "Freelance project"). |
| Type | Text (Income / Expense) | Determines whether entry increases or decreases net balance. |
| Amount (USD) | Number (2 decimal places) | Numeric value of the transaction. |
| Budgeted Amount | Number (2 decimal places, optional) | Planned amount for this category (used for variance tracking). |
| Payment Method | Text (Dropdown: Cash, Debit Card, Credit Card, Bank Transfer) | Marks how the transaction was made. |
3. Process Documentation Log Sheet
This table captures qualitative and procedural insights related to financial decisions:
| Column | Data Type | Description |
|---|---|---|
| Date of Decision | Date (DD/MM/YYYY) | Date when the financial change was made. |
| Change Type | Text (Dropdown: Budget Adjustment, Goal Update, Emergency Adjustment, Strategy Change) | Categorizes the nature of the process change. |
| Category Affected | Text (from dropdown) | Which budget category was modified. |
| Description of Change | Long Text (up to 500 characters) | Detailed explanation of what changed and why. |
| Justification / Rationale | Long Text (up to 1000 characters) | Documents the reasoning, external factors (e.g., medical emergency), or long-term strategy behind the change. |
| Status | Text (Draft, Reviewed, Approved) | Tracks document maturity for personal accountability. |
Formulas Required
The template relies on dynamic formulas to maintain accuracy and provide real-time insights:
- Total Income (Summary Dashboard):
=SUMIF('Monthly Budget Tracker'!$D:$D, "Income", 'Monthly Budget Tracker'!$E:$E) - Total Expenses:
=SUMIF('Monthly Budget Tracker'!$D:$D, "Expense", 'Monthly Budget Tracker'!$E:$E) - Net Savings:
=[Total Income] - [Total Expenses] - Budget Variance (by Category):
=SUMIFS('Monthly Budget Tracker'!$E:$E, 'Monthly Budget Tracker'!$C:$C, "Housing") - SUMIFS('Monthly Budget Tracker'!$F:$F, 'Monthly Budget Tracker'!$C:$C, "Housing") - Spending Percentage:
=[Category Amount] / [Total Expenses] - Count of Process Documentation Entries:
=COUNTA('Process Documentation Log'!$A:$A), used to track documentation frequency.
Conditional Formatting
To enhance visual clarity and highlight key insights, the following rules are applied:
- Budget Overrun (Red): If actual amount exceeds budgeted amount in a category → Format: Red fill with white text.
- Budget Underrun (Green): If actual amount is below budgeted → Green fill with white text.
- Savings Rate Highlight: Conditional formatting based on percentage of income saved. E.g., ≥10% → Blue highlight; <5% → Yellow warning.
- Process Documentation Status: "Draft" appears in gray, "Reviewed" in orange, "Approved" in green (for visual tracking).
User Instructions
To use this template effectively:
- Set Up Your Budget: Begin by defining your monthly income and target allocations under the "Data Reference & Setup" sheet.
- Add Transactions: Input each financial transaction in the "Monthly Budget Tracker" with accurate date, category, and amount.
- Update Process Documentation: After major budget changes or financial decisions, document them in the "Process Documentation Log" using clear rationale.
- Analyze Dashboard: Regularly review the "Summary Dashboard" to assess progress toward financial goals and identify trends.
- Review & Reflect: At month-end, analyze both quantitative results (budget vs actual) and qualitative insights (process documentation) to refine future strategies.
